Capitol Theatre

The Capitol Theatre opened at 820 Granville Street in March 1921, with 2,500 seats. Artist Alfredo Dalfo apparently created, or helped to create, this original plasterwork for the theatre. In April 1976 he provided these images to the Vancouver Province for an article being written about the Orpheum Theatre restoration project, published as "Adding a touch of class" on May 5 1976. Dalfo worked on the original decorations for both theatres. These actual 8 x 10 inch black and white photographic prints were found by chance in April 2025 at The Paper Hound bookstore on Pender Street, 50 years after they were developed and printed, and 105 years after the photographs were taken!

Based on the size of the doorway in the second photograph, this plasterwork was easily 12 to 15 feet high and about ten feet wide.
